WebThe Tax-Free First Home Savings Account is a new registered account that provides tax-free savings for first-time home buyers. Maximum annual contributions of $8,000 and a lifetime total of $40,000. No minimum holding period required for contributions to be deductible and eligible for withdrawal. WebJan 5, 2024 · get started. 1. The maximum size of the withdrawal. The Home Buyers’ Plan allows you to withdraw up to $35,000 from your RRSP. This was increased from $25,000 in March 2024. If you’re buying your first home with your partner (or another first-time homebuyer) then you can withdraw a maximum of $70,000.
